Sciatica is a set of symptoms associated with a pinched nerve. The sciatic nerve is a long and central nerve, so sciatica sufferers can experience severe and recurring pain through a large part of the body. The nerve helps you move your lower body by linking the spine (and spinal cord) with muscles in the lower back, legs, buttocks and feet. When compressed and irritated, pain can extend throughout the lower body and lower extremities. You may also feel a burning sensation, along with a degree of numbness or “pins and needles” in any of the areas connected by the sciatic nerve.
Unique Signs of Sciatica
Sciatica pain is distinguished from other types of lower body pain because:
- Symptoms occur on one side (in one leg, for example), rather than both
- Pain is sharp and sudden, rather than a slow, continual ache
- Pain radiates from the lower back and thigh down to the foot
- Symptoms typically decrease if you walk or lie down

Diagnosis is key to treating sciatica effectively, so that the true cause can be targeted. Symptoms may be slightly different depending upon the nerve root from which the pain stems. Pain may originate from compression in the middle of the lumbar spine (L3 to L4), the lower lumbar area (L4 to L5) and the base of the spine (L5 to S1). Our Scottsdale chiropractor, Dr. Daniel P.
